ONE of the most interesting and significant events which have taken place, has been the visit of 'Abdu'l- Baha to London. The Persian Mage whose life, passed in prison, has been spent in promoting peace and unity by the one certain method of aiding individual spiritual development, must in a very real sense have "tasted of the travail of his soul and been satisfied". Not only was he visited privately by nearly every earnest truth- seeker and leader of high thought in London, but his message was made known to thousands who had but dimly heard his name before.
